Why a plan is required ?

Making a study plan will help you nail the exam perfectly.

  • Strategize on how many hours you can spend on each topic and revision for the same.
  • Making a timetable as per the syllabus with days and hours dedicated to each subject will help you complete the topics and be ready for the upcoming exam.
  • Solving different types of questions within the time frame will help you know how quick and prepared you are when you approach the exam.
  • The last week of the exam has to get dedicated to solving a lot of old question papers. It will help you know how much time you can allocate to each question.
  • There is so much information online, and you can take up this option for your extra reading, which is vital for such competitive exams.
